Cement Grinding Cement Plant Optimization. Water Spray in Cement Mills. Water spray installed generally in second compartment of ball mill to control cement temperature. Cement discharge temperature should be kept below about 110 o C but, the same time should allow some 60% dehydration of gypsum to . get price

If the temperature of grinding cement is too high, you can use a cement cooler to reduce it. Cold water with temperature of 15 ° C can reduce the cement temperature from 110 ℃ to 65 ℃.

A 10 MW cement mill, output 270 tonnes per hour. A cement mill (or finish mill in North American usage [1]) is the equipment used to grind the hard, nodular clinker from the cement kiln into the fine grey powder that is cement. Most cement is currently ground in ball mills.

The heat is generated when the ball impact each other and this is the source of your heat in the mill. Below are some guidelines for cement mill temperatures in first and second compartments: Intermediate diaphragm - maintain temperature around 100 [°C] Mill discharge (product or air) -Ideal 100 – 120 [°C] - Air normally 5 [°C] lower than material

8.3.2.2 Ball mills. The ball mill is a tumbling mill that uses steel balls as the grinding media. The length of the cylindrical shell is usually 1–1.5 times the shell diameter ( Figure 8.11). The feed can be dry, with less than 3% moisture to minimize ball …
